1.4m see new comedy from 'League' gents
added by newsBotBBC Two's Psychoville got off to a fair start last night, according to the latest viewing figures. The new comedy-thriller, starring The League Of Gentlemen's Reece Shearsmith and Steve Pemberton, averaged 1.44m (7.3%) between 10pm and 10.30pm. Earlier on the channel, Springwatch pulled in 2.02m (9.8%) during the 8pm hour, then the half-hour Matt Lucas comedy Kröd Mändoon And The Flaming Sword Of Fire took 1.25m (5.8%) at 9pm, followed by That Mitchell And Webb Look, which was seen by 1.1m (5.1%). Over on BBC One, Celebrity Masterchef put in 4.35m (21.1%) at 8pm, then the third installment of James Nesbitt-fronted drama Occupation followed with 3.31m (15.4%). The Bill led the 8pm hour with 4.44m (21.6%) for ITV1. The audience then fell to 2.84m (13.3%) during the 9pm screening of May Contain Nuts.
